ToggleCensor Board Approval and Rating
The Central Board of Film Certification (CBFC) has officially cleared the upcoming promotional asset. The certification ensures that the epic will be accessible to the widest possible audience.
- Certification Date: The “Rama” asset was passed by the board on March 30, 2026.
- Official Rating: The teaser has been granted a ‘U’ (Universal) rating, making it suitable for all age groups.
- Universal Appeal: This rating aligns with the makers’ intent to share the story of Lord Rama with families and children globally.

Teaser Runtime and Content Expectations
Fans can expect a substantial look at the film rather than a fleeting montage. Reports indicate that the length of the clip is akin to a full theatrical trailer.
- Total Runtime: The “Rama” glimpse clocks in at 2 minutes and 38 seconds (158 seconds).
- Visual Scope: It is expected to showcase the high-end VFX, the film’s grand scale, and the first detailed look at Ranbir Kapoor’s transformation.
- Musical Soul: The clip will likely feature the first strains of the collaboration between Hans Zimmer and A.R. Rahman.
A Special Hanuman Jayanti Release
The timing of the release carries immense spiritual significance for the team and the fans. The “Rama” glimpse is scheduled to drop on Thursday, April 2.
- Auspicious Occasion: The release coincides with Hanuman Jayanti, symbolizing the devotion and strength of Lord Hanuman.
- Global Reveal: Producer Namit Malhotra confirmed the date via Instagram, thanking fans for their “faith and patience” over the years.
- World Premiere: The teaser follows a secret screening in Los Angeles where select audiences were treated to the first visuals on an IMAX screen.

Stellar Cast and Iconic Roles
The film features a star-studded ensemble cast from across various Indian film industries, bringing together some of the biggest names in cinema.
- Ranbir Kapoor: Portraying the central figure, Lord Rama.
- Sai Pallavi: Taking on the role of Sita.
- Yash: The Rocking Star will portray the formidable Ravana.
- Sunny Deol: Stepping into the role of the mighty Hanuman.
- Ravie Dubey: Cast as the loyal brother, Lakshman.
Behind the Scenes in Los Angeles
Before the public digital release, the core team took the project to the global stage for a high-profile preview.
- IMAX Screening: Ranbir Kapoor, Nitesh Tiwari, and Namit Malhotra debuted the visuals at an IMAX theatre in LA.
- Initial Reviews: Early reports from the screening have been overwhelmingly positive, with viewers praising the “goosebump-inducing” portrayal of Rama.
- Actor’s Perspective: Ranbir Kapoor described Lord Rama as the “conscience keeper of billions” during a Q&A session at the event.
Roadmap to the Big Screen
The project is designed as a massive two-part saga to ensure the depth of the narrative is fully explored.
- Part 1 Release: Scheduled for a worldwide debut on Diwali 2026.
- Part 2 Release: Expected to follow exactly a year later on Diwali 2027.
- Visual Legacy: With a reported massive budget, the film aims to be a landmark in Indian VFX and mythological storytelling.
